Your .env File Is Lying to You
This video breaks down env vars from the operating system level up — where they live, how they move between processes, and why your app works locally but breaks in Docker. Environment variables aren't a framework feature — they're an OS primitive. Every process on your machine carries its own flat list of key-value strings. We'll walk through the four layers where env vars get set (OS defaults, shell profiles, manual commands, and application tooling like dotenv). Then we get into process inheritance — the reason Docker containers and CI steps don't see your local variables. Finally, we tackle the build-time vs runtime distinction. Timestamps: 0:00 Intro 0:44 What Environment Variables Actually Are 1:33 Where Do They Come From? 3:39 Process Inheritance 5:09 Build-Time vs Runtime 8:30 Recap More Videos : Software Egineering Basics - • Software Engineering Basics Software Design - • Software Design #environmentvariables #webdev #devops

Git Will Finally Make Sense After This

A WebSocket Is an HTTP Request That Stops Being HTTP

Zig 2026: No-AI Policy, $670K Foundation, Left GitHub & Why Zig Isn’t 1.0 - Andrew Kelley Explains

Tom & Dave discover DotVVM | E02

Your iPhone is Lying to You About Files...

I Wish Someone Explained The Linux Filesystem Like This

Android 17 sucks. So I put Linux on a phone.

Linus Torvalds: AI Is Changing Linux Fast

Every Level of Reverse Engineering Explained

Stop putting secrets in .env

Postgres can replace your entire stack...

99% of Developers Don't Get Docker

Abstract Black and White wave pattern| Height Map Footage| 3 hours Topographic 4k Background

TOTAL IDIOTS AT WORK #103 | Instant Regret Fails Compilation 2025 | Best Fails of the Month

I Hacked This Temu Router. What I Found Should Be Illegal.

The End of .env Files as We Know Them

99% of Developers Don't Get Sockets

248 DIOS TE DICE HOY: NADA ES IMPOSIBLE PARA MÍ | CONFÍA EN DIOS

Stop Copying CORS Headers - CORS Explained

